The viña is the place where the grapes used to produce wine are planted. Another common name for this plantation is Viñedo.
This plantation uses a system where people do not water the plants, but only use rainwater, and this process is called secano (dry land).
The vineyards have great care from the farmers, since the more they take care of them, the better quality the wine they make will have.
